Jason English Wins World Solo 24Hr Championship
Posted Date: 10/9/2010
Printer Friendly Version Email A Friend Add This Increase Text Size Decrease Text Size
Australia's Jason English was the only solo rider to complete 24 laps of the Canberra, Australia, course to secure his second 24HRS of Adrenalin World Solo 24HR MTB Championship. Jason used a Pivot Mach 4 to set a blistering pace for the first ten laps, establishing a lead that would allow him to ride wisely through the night (where his lap times were the fastest of the top contenders). Full results are listed by clicking here.

Jessica Douglas won the Elite women's class where four riders were on the same lap (20) after 24 hours of racing. Full results are listed by clicking here.


Jason English likes to go long. The win was his second Solo World Championship and his first on a Pivot.
